Part Overview
The MVK50VC22RMH63TP is a 22 µF, 50 V aluminum electrolytic capacitor manufactured by Chemi-Con in surface mount radial can package. This component is classified as obsolete, indicating discontinuation from the manufacturer. The part operates across a temperature range of -40°C to 105°C with a rated lifetime of 2000 hours at 105°C, suitable for general-purpose applications requiring stable capacitance and low equivalent series resistance.
Identification of equivalent and substitute parts is necessary due to the obsolete status of the MVK50VC22RMH63TP. Active alternatives with matching or enhanced electrical characteristics are available from multiple manufacturers, ensuring design continuity and supply chain reliability.

Engineering Selection Recommendations
For Direct Replacement (Same Electrical Specifications):
UUX1H220MCL1GS (Nichicon) is the primary direct equivalent. This part maintains identical capacitance (22 µF), voltage rating (50 V), tolerance (±20%), and lifetime (2000 Hrs @ 105°C). The part is currently active and available in high volume (111,300 pcs in stock). Operating temperature range extends to -55°C, providing enhanced low-temperature performance. Surface mount land size and package dimensions are identical to the original part. RoHS3 compliance and unlimited moisture sensitivity level (MSL 1) align with modern manufacturing standards.
For Upgraded Performance (Higher Voltage Rating):
AFK226M63E16T-F and AFK226M63E16VT-F (Cornell Dubilier Electronics) provide upgraded voltage rating of 63 V while maintaining 22 µF capacitance and ±20% tolerance. Both parts feature significantly reduced ESR (1.2 Ohm @ 100kHz compared to 9.041 Ohm @ 120Hz), improved ripple current handling (90 mA @ 120 Hz), and AEC-Q200 automotive qualification. Operating temperature range extends to -55°C. The primary difference between these two parts is seated height: AFK226M63E16T-F measures 0.256" (6.50mm) while AFK226M63E16VT-F measures 0.268" (6.80mm). Both require modified surface mount land size (0.327" L x 0.374" W) compared to the original 0.327" L x 0.327" W. These parts are suitable for applications requiring higher voltage margin and lower impedance characteristics.
EEE-FK1J220P (Panasonic) offers 63 V rating with identical capacitance and tolerance. This part maintains the original surface mount land size (0.327" L x 0.327" W), eliminating PCB layout modifications. AEC-Q200 certification and active product status ensure long-term availability. Ripple current capability is 90 mA @ 120 Hz with 120 mA @ 100 kHz high-frequency performance.
For Cost-Sensitive Applications (Same Voltage, Reduced Lifetime):
EEE-HA1H220P (Panasonic) maintains 50 V rating and 22 µF capacitance with identical surface mount land size. This part is marked "Not For New Designs" and features reduced lifetime of 1000 Hrs @ 105°C compared to 2000 Hrs. Selection of this part is appropriate only when lifetime requirements are reduced and cost optimization is prioritized. RoHS compliance and AEC-Q200 certification are provided.
Compliance and Certification Considerations:
The original MVK50VC22RMH63TP is RoHS non-compliant. All recommended substitutes (UUX1H220MCL1GS, AFK226M63E16T-F, AFK226M63E16VT-F, EEE-FK1J220P) are RoHS3 compliant, meeting current environmental regulations. The upgrade parts from Cornell Dubilier and Panasonic carry AEC-Q200 automotive qualification, suitable for automotive and industrial applications requiring enhanced reliability standards.
Frequently Asked Questions (FAQ)
Q1: Can UUX1H220MCL1GS directly replace MVK50VC22RMH63TP without PCB modifications?
A: Yes. UUX1H220MCL1GS is a direct equivalent with identical capacitance (22 µF), voltage rating (50 V), tolerance (±20%), lifetime (2000 Hrs @ 105°C), and surface mount land size (0.327" L x 0.327" W). The seated height differs slightly (0.256" vs. 0.248"), but this does not affect electrical performance or standard PCB assembly processes. No design changes are required.
Q2: What is the advantage of using AFK226M63E16T-F or AFK226M63E16VT-F over the direct equivalent?
A: These parts provide higher voltage rating (63 V vs. 50 V), offering increased design margin for voltage transients and overshoot conditions. ESR is significantly reduced (1.2 Ohm @ 100kHz vs. 9.041 Ohm @ 120Hz), resulting in lower impedance and improved high-frequency ripple current handling (120 mA @ 100 kHz). AEC-Q200 automotive qualification provides enhanced reliability certification. The trade-off is modified surface mount land size (0.327" L x 0.374" W), requiring PCB layout adjustment.
Q3: Why does EEE-FK1J220P maintain the original surface mount land size while the Cornell Dubilier parts do not?
A: Surface mount land size is determined by the manufacturer's specific package design and lead frame geometry. Panasonic's FK series maintains the 0.327" L x 0.327" W land size, while Cornell Dubilier's AFK series uses 0.327" L x 0.374" W. Both are valid 22 µF 63 V SMD aluminum electrolytic capacitors in radial can packages, but with different mechanical footprints. PCB design must accommodate the specific land size of the selected part.
Q4: Is EEE-HA1H220P suitable for long-term reliability applications?
A: EEE-HA1H220P features reduced lifetime of 1000 Hrs @ 105°C compared to 2000 Hrs for the original part and other substitutes. This part is marked "Not For New Designs," indicating it is in end-of-life status. Selection is appropriate only for cost-sensitive applications where reduced lifetime is acceptable and long-term supply is not critical. For new designs requiring 2000-hour lifetime, UUX1H220MCL1GS or the upgraded 63 V parts are recommended.
Q5: What is the impact of operating temperature range differences?
A: The original MVK50VC22RMH63TP operates from -40°C to 105°C. Direct equivalent UUX1H220MCL1GS and upgrade parts (AFK226M63E16T-F, AFK226M63E16VT-F, EEE-FK1J220P) extend the lower limit to -55°C. This provides enhanced performance in cold-temperature environments. For applications operating only above -40°C, this difference is not significant. For applications requiring operation below -40°C, the extended range of substitute parts is beneficial.
Q6: Are all substitute parts available in Tape & Reel packaging?
A: Yes. All recommended substitute parts (UUX1H220MCL1GS, AFK226M63E16T-F, AFK226M63E16VT-F, EEE-FK1J220P, EEE-HA1H220P) are supplied in Tape & Reel (TR) packaging, suitable for automated surface mount assembly processes. Moisture Sensitivity Level (MSL) is 1 (Unlimited) for all parts, indicating no special moisture control requirements during storage and handling.
Q7: Which substitute part is recommended for automotive applications?
A: For automotive applications, AFK226M63E16T-F, AFK226M63E16VT-F, or EEE-FK1J220P are recommended. All three parts carry AEC-Q200 automotive qualification and are rated for automotive, bypass, and decoupling applications. These parts provide enhanced reliability standards required for automotive environments. UUX1H220MCL1GS, while active and compliant, does not carry AEC-Q200 certification and is designated for general-purpose applications.
